Review committee approves several ag-related bill-draft requests; timeline and submission deadlines explained

Water Resources and Agriculture Review Committee
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

The committee approved four bill-draft requests covering agricultural taxation ("ranch" definition), housing the Colorado Farmers Market Association within CDA, protection of agricultural geographic indicators, and limits on large green-energy projects on agricultural lands; OLLS outlined drafting and timeline requirements.

During the committee's closing business, members approved multiple bill-draft requests and received a short briefing on legislative timelines from the Office of Legislative Legal Services.
